Bhubaneswar: The Odisha capital saw another 326 people testing positive for COVID-19 in the last 24 hours, which pushed the affected tally past 2000.
According to Bhubaneswar Municipal Corporation (BMC), 70 are quarantine and 256 local contact cases.
The city has been reporting over 300 cases daily for the last several days.
The last 24 hours also saw four more COVID-19 deaths and 392 recoveries.

While the total infection touched 20219 on Friday, 16511 have been cured so far. Bhubaneswar now has 3612 active cases.
